In addition to the same high-performance M1 chip as the iPad Pro, it also has Touch ID that the iPad Pro does not have

First, I will explain the features of the 5th generation iPad Air. “Apple M1” is installed in the system-on-chip that is the brain of this machine. It is a chip designed by Apple that has the same high processing performance and power saving performance as the current iPad Pro.

On the other hand, there are some parts that are the same as the 4th generation iPad Air, such as an all-screen design that does not have operation parts such as buttons on the front side, and the size of the main body is 178.5 width × 247.6 height × 6.1 mm thickness.

↑ By making it an all-screen design, you can relax and enjoy not only videos and photos but also contents such as games and e-books.

The Touch ID fingerprint authentication sensor, which securely unlocks the screen and makes electronic payments using Apple Pay while identifying the user’s fingerprint, is built into the top button on the side of the iPad Air. This top button embedded Touch ID fingerprint sensor has also been adopted for the 6th generation iPad mini.

I mainly use the iPad Pro with Face ID, but sometimes I find it inconvenient to be unable to unlock the screen while wearing a mask when I’m on the go, and the 5th generation iPad Air that can perform fingerprint authentication is that. In terms of points, it makes me want it.

↑ Built-in Touch ID fingerprint authentication sensor on the top button on the side of the main unit.The screen will be unlocked as soon as you touch it with your finger with the registered fingerprint.

The fact that you can use a genuine Apple keyboard is a charm that the iPad mini does not have

The 5th generation iPad Air can use genuine Apple keyboard accessories such as the Magic Keyboard (34,980 yen including tax) and Smart Keyboard Folio (21,800 yen including tax) that connect to the Smart Connector. These do not require Bluetooth pairing settings or separate charging.

In addition to the iPad stand that allows you to adjust the angle of the screen, it also serves as a robust cover, so it’s a little expensive accessory, but if you use it for various purposes, you should be able to recover it firmly.

In terms of portability, the 6th generation iPad mini with an 8.3-inch Liquid Retina display is also an attractive tablet, but it does not support this genuine Apple keyboard, and it is a big difference from the 5th generation iPad Air in the user experience. The iPad Air is more “beginner-friendly” than the unbranded iPad because of its second-generation Apple Pencil and all-screen design.

The 9th generation iPad is also an excellent tablet that strongly supports remote work and remote school. The performance achieved by the A13 Bionic chip is clearly not inferior to that of the 5th generation iPad Air, and “what you can do” such as mobile data communication by 4G LTE, fingerprint authentication by Touch ID, and support for Smart Keyboard. You will not feel any shortage.

The 64GB Wi-Fi model with the least storage capacity is as cheap as 39,800 yen (tax included), so the cost performance is perfect.

However, the more seriously you use the iPad, the more you may start to worry about the details of the basic model, MUJI iPad. In particular, the usability of Apple Pencil is very different.

The 2nd generation Apple Pencil, which is not supported by MUJI iPad and can be used with the 5th generation iPad Air, is lighter, more compact and easier to handle. In addition, the display of the 5th generation iPad Air supports anti-reflection coating. Furthermore, due to the technology of the full lamination display, there is almost no gap from the liquid crystal panel to the pen tip, so you can get a comfortable writing feeling as if handwritten characters and lines stick to the pen tip.

The typing feeling of the keyboard is different for each person, but I feel a little uncomfortable with the soft keystroke feeling of the Smart Keyboard compatible with the MUJI iPad.

Another thing is that the unbranded iPad has a home button with a built-in Touch ID fingerprint authentication sensor on the display side, so the immersive feeling when displaying videos and game images will still be enhanced by the all-screen design iPad Air.
